What Malysia Means

Likely an invented name inspired by the country Malaysia, suggesting exoticism and a connection to Southeast Asia. It evokes a sense of global diversity.

The Story of Malysia

This name is a whisper of distant shores, a modern echo of lands where spice winds carry ancient stories.

Emerging from English naming trends around 2015, Malysia is a melodic invented name. It draws its sonic charm from the vibrant Southeast Asian country of Malaysia, suggesting a worldly and adventurous spirit.
